Take the wind tunnel proven, aerodynamic TTX frame, pair it with what has been called 'the hands-down winner' of mid-range gruppos--SRAM's Rival kit--and infuse it with Bontrager's Race Lite Aero wheelset. That's a recipe for not only a faster bike leg, but also more energy left in the tank for the run.

I've got the '07 model w/ the Flying Ace paint job. This bike just flat out goes. The Ultegra components have worked flawlessly. The frame is very stiff, but yet manages to give a comfortable ride. I bought a set of Bontrager Aeolus 5.0 tubies to race with and I love them. When you get to a bike of this level, the bike will no longer hold you back.

The only thing that I am considering changing is the aero bars. I'd like to try a set of S-bends.

Stiff frame and very aero, but comfortable. I had LBS switch Cranks (to ultegra) and added Aeolus 5.0 clinchers as race day wheels and koobi enduro saddle. Have been racing this setup for a little over a year. I will race this bike for years to come.

I thought I would miss my Cannondale but not anymore, effortlessly on the legs. I will make the run portion a breeze with fresh legs. It sure is fast. Love it..
